免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

vite打包成app

Vite 是一个由尤雨溪(Vue.js 创始人)开发的下一代前端构建工具。它的核心特点是快速、简单和易于扩展。Vite 使用了现代浏览器原生的 ES 模块化特性,能够实现快速的开发和构建流程。

Vite 支持将应用程序打包成 App,可以通过打包后的 App 在移动设备上运行。这个过程中,我们需要使用一些工具和技术来完成。

首先,我们需要安装 Vite。可以通过 npm 或 yarn 来进行安装:

```bash

npm install -g vite

```

或者

```bash

yarn global add vite

```

安装完成后,我们可以使用以下命令来创建一个新的 Vite 项目:

```bash

npm init vite-app my-app

```

或者

```bash

yarn create vite-app my-app

```

这个命令会创建一个新的 Vite 项目,并且安装所有依赖项。接下来,我们需要将应用程序打包成 App。

在打包应用程序之前,我们需要使用一个工具来将应用程序编译成原生代码。这个工具可以是 React Native、Ionic 或者 PhoneGap 等。这里我们以 React Native 为例。

首先,我们需要在应用程序中安装 React Native:

```bash

npm install react-native

```

或者

```bash

yarn add react-native

```

安装完成后,我们需要在项目的根目录下创建一个名为 `index.js` 的文件,这个文件是应用程序的入口文件。在 `index.js` 中,我们需要引入 React Native 的一些组件,并且使用这些组件来构建应用程序。

```javascript

import React from 'react';

import { View, Text } from 'react-native';

const App = () => {

return (

Hello, World!

);

};

export default App;

```

接下来,我们需要在项目的根目录下创建一个名为 `App.js` 的文件,这个文件是应用程序的主要组件。在 `App.js` 中,我们需要引入 React 和 `index.js` 文件,然后使用这些文件来构建应用程序。

```javascript

import React from 'react';

import { AppRegistry } from 'react-native';

import App from './index';

AppRegistry.registerComponent('MyApp', () => App);

```

最后,我们需要使用 React Native 的命令行工具来将应用程序打包成 App。可以使用以下命令来进行打包:

```bash

npx react-native run-ios

```

或者

```bash

npx react-native run-android

```

这个命令会将应用程序打包成 iOS 或 Android App,并且在模拟器或者真实设备上运行。

总结来说,将 Vite 应用程序打包成 App 的过程中,我们需要使用 React Native 或者其他类似的工具来将应用程序编译成原生代码,并且使用这些工具来构建应用程序。通过这些步骤,我们可以将 Vite 应用程序打包成 App,并且在移动设备上运行。


相关知识:
railsapp打包
Rails是一款非常流行的Web应用程序框架,许多网站都是基于这个框架构建的。Rails应用程序在开发和部署过程中,需要进行打包以便于发布和管理。本文将介绍Rails应用程序打包的原理和详细步骤。一、Rails应用程序打包的原理Rails应用程序打包的原理
2023-04-06
html文件打包安卓
在互联网领域中,我们经常会遇到需要将网页转化为APP的需求。这时候,我们就需要将HTML文件打包成安卓应用程序。这样,用户就可以在手机上直接安装使用。接下来,我们就来详细介绍一下如何将HTML文件打包成安卓应用程序。一、安装Android Studio首先
2023-04-06
打包电脑app
打包电脑App是一项非常重要的技术,它可以将软件打包成一个可执行文件,方便用户进行安装和使用。本文将介绍打包电脑App的原理和详细步骤。一、打包电脑App的原理打包电脑App的原理类似于打包手机App,它需要将软件的各个组件(如程序文件、库文件、资源文件等
2023-04-06
无证书打包ipa
打包IPA是iOS应用程序的一种分发方式,通常需要使用Xcode或第三方打包工具完成。但是,有时候我们需要在不具备Xcode或者开发者账号的情况下打包IPA文件,这时就需要使用无证书打包IPA的方法。无证书打包IPA的原理是通过模拟苹果开发者账号的方式来完
2023-04-06
access打包成app
Access是一款微软公司开发的关系型数据库管理系统,它可以用来管理和处理大量的数据。在日常工作中,我们常常需要使用Access来进行数据的录入、查询、分析和报表制作等操作。而如果我们将Access打包成一个独立的应用程序,就可以方便地在其他计算机上运行,
2023-04-06
网站打包成电脑客户端
网站打包成电脑客户端是一种将网站封装成可在本地计算机上运行的应用程序的方法。这种方法的优点是能够提供更好的用户体验,同时也能够提高网站的安全性和性能。在本文中,我们将详细介绍如何将网站打包成电脑客户端。首先,我们需要了解网站打包成客户端的原理。网站是由HT
2023-04-06
制作ipa应用
IPA是iOS应用程序的打包文件格式。它包含了应用程序的二进制文件和相关资源文件。在iOS设备上安装应用程序时,首先需要将IPA文件安装到设备上,然后将其解压缩并安装应用程序。制作IPA应用的步骤如下:1.准备开发环境为了制作IPA应用,您需要一台Mac电
2023-04-06
ios打包书签
iOS 打包书签是指将一个网页添加到 Safari 浏览器的书签列表中,并在书签列表中创建一个快速访问图标。这个图标通常会呈现为一个网站的图标,也称为 Favicon。iOS 打包书签的原理是通过 Safari 浏览器的“添加到主屏幕”功能来实现。在添加到
2023-04-06
在线打包h5
H5是一种基于HTML5技术的移动端网页开发技术,可以用于开发各种移动端应用,包括游戏、工具、社交、生活等等。在线打包H5是一种将H5应用打包成APP的技术,可以让开发者快速地将H5应用转化为Android或iOS应用,提高应用的可用性和用户体验。下面我们
2023-04-06
webapp打包安卓
WebApp是一种基于Web技术开发的应用程序,可以跨平台运行。而将WebApp打包成安卓应用程序的方式,就是通过将WebApp嵌入到一个原生应用程序中,让它可以在移动设备上以原生应用程序的形式运行。下面将详细介绍WebApp打包成安卓应用程序的原理和步骤
2023-04-06
pyqt5打包apk
PyQt5是Python语言中的GUI工具包,它可以帮助我们快速构建出漂亮的图形界面应用程序。而打包成apk文件则是将PyQt5应用程序打包成安卓应用程序的过程。本文将介绍PyQt5打包apk的原理和详细步骤。一、原理介绍在安卓系统中,应用程序是以Java
2023-04-06
苹果手机系统打包
苹果手机系统打包是指将苹果手机系统中的各个组件和应用程序打包成一个整体,以便于安装和使用。这个过程需要使用专业的打包工具和技术,以下是详细介绍。首先,苹果手机系统的打包需要使用Xcode,这是苹果公司提供的开发工具,可以用于创建、测试、打包和发布iOS应用
2023-04-06